New 500,000 square feet facility to add new services and 240 new patient beds
18 July 2010 (Dubai, UAE): The American Hospital Dubai has begun the roll-out of its new In-patient Bed Tower, with the opening of the first of the facilities to be located there. The newly designed and refurbished Total Joint Replacement Regional Center of Excellence is the first unit to be relocated to the fifth floor of the new building, with 44 in-patient rooms, and medical/surgical units and supporting areas. A new 20-bed maternity unit (labor and delivery) will open shortly, with its eight delivery suites, two c-section rooms, 10-bed neonatal ICU (intensive care unit) and a well-baby nursery. The new facility will be fully occupied and operational before the end of 2010.
The new In-patient Bed Tower will add 240 new patient beds (all private rooms and 30 per cent larger than the original Hospital patient rooms) to the existing campus, as well as a range of new services. The facility has a total of seven floors with a two-level underground car park (263 spaces), covering a built up area of almost half a million square feet (50,000 square meters). The In-patient Bed Tower is the latest in a series of developments being undertaken by the Hospital at the Dubai campus and follows the opening of a new outpatient clinic building, which resulted in a doubling of the medical staff at the Hospital.

The new In-patient Bed Tower is located at the Southeast corner of the campus and interconnects with the rest of the Hospital for easy access. In addition to the new tower, several other Hospital renovation projects are ongoing including seven new Emergency Department Treatment Exam Rooms which will constitute a new 'Urgent Care Service'. The Hospital will roll out further new services at the In-patient Bed Tower through the year and expects the bed tower to be fully occupied and operational by December 2010.

About the American Hospital Dubai
The American Hospital Dubai is a 143 bed, acute care, general medical/surgical private hospital with a 60 physician multi-specialty group practice, designed to provide high quality, American standard of healthcare to meet the needs and exceed the expectations of the people of Dubai, the UAE and the surrounding Gulf States. The American Hospital Dubai became the first hospital in the Middle East to be awarded JCI accreditation in May 2000 and successfully underwent further surveys by the JCI in 2003 and in 2006 to maintain its accredited status.
The American Hospital Dubai has expanded to meet the demand for more personalized services, comfort and convenience, while broadening the services and deepening the level of expertise and care offered. In response to the strong increase in local and regional demand for its services, the hospital constructed a new state of the art Outpatient Clinic Building. In addition to the new facilities and services, the hospital continues its ongoing physician recruitment plan, which will extend the number of American Board Certified or equivalent practicing physicians at the Hospital from 60 to 110 over the next two years. The hospital's new bed tower currently under construction (due to complete in 2010) will transform the hospital into a 383 bed hospital.
